Want to earn while you learn from the best team in law? Our Legal Apprenticeship will give you practical insight into a career in the legal sector and help develop transferable skills that will be valued in any profession. "An apprenticeship is a really great way to go into law because you're learning from the ground up, you get to work with professionals every day and you get to apply what you're learning in class straight into practice." Jasmine, Apprentice Solicitor The programme Our programme allows you to qualify as a solicitor by completing the Level 3 Paralegal and Level 7 Solicitor apprenticeships over a period of six years. You will spend 4 days a week working at the firm under the supervision of qualified lawyers and 1 day studying towards formal legal qualifications. Our training

provider is BPP University. Throughout the apprenticeship you will have the opportunity to spend time in several of our legal departments. All positions will be based at One Glass Wharf, our Bristol HQ, only five minutes' walk from Temple Meads station. We are taking on 4 legal apprentices to start with the firm in September 2025. Entry requirements GCSEs: grades 4 and above are essential. (A to C under the old scoring system). You will need to have achieved at least a 6 in Maths and English (B). A Levels / Level 3 qualifications: equivalent to BBB / 120 UCAS points. You must be 16 or over by the end of the summer holidays 2024, have lived in England or Wales for at least 3 years and completed full-time education before the start of the apprenticeship. Unfortunately, we do not currently offer a graduate solicitor apprenticeship and therefore are not able to accept Law graduates onto our apprenticeship programme.
